We are currently seeking an Anaplan Engineer to join our Planning and Consolidation technology team. This team plays a crucial role in supporting the FP&A (financial planning and analysis) and Finance departments during the month end close processes and the planning cycles.
As Anaplan Engineer, you will work closely with various stakeholders, managing the Global and Local financial planning solutions. You will also be responsible for developing new functionalities in the planning landscape.
What will you do?
Translate business user requirements into technical developments, leveraging Proof of Concepts (POCs) and mock-ups.
Support FP&A teams during the Month end close and planning cycles.
Act as primary contact for internal stakeholders regarding Anaplan, budget modeling and reporting automation.
Contribute to the Anaplan Center of Excellence organization by defining best practices, maintaining processes & solution documentation, and bringing new ideas.
Challenge business to explore and generate new insights based on Anaplan data.
Stay updated with the latest Anaplan and related systems functionalities as well as industry best practices on data modeling, planning and process definition.
